Java使用FTPClient类读写FTP

本文实例为大家分享了Java使用FTPClient类读写FTP的具体代码,供大家参考,具体内容如下

1.首先先导入相关jar包

2.创建一个连接FTP的工具类FTPUtil.java

package com.metarnet.ftp.util; 

import java.io.IOException;

import java.io.InputStream;

import java.net.SocketException;

import java.util.Properties;

import org.apache.commons.net.ftp.FTPClient;

import org.apache.commons.net.ftp.FTPReply;

import org.apache.log4j.Logger;

public class FTPUtil {

private static Logger logger = Logger.getLogger(FTPUtil.class);

/**

* 获取FTPClient对象

* @param ftpHost FTP主机服务器

* @param ftpPassword FTP 登录密码

* @param ftpUserName FTP登录用户名

* @param ftpPort FTP端口 默认为21

* @return

*/

public static FTPClient getFTPClient(String ftpHost, String ftpPassword,

String ftpUserName, int ftpPort) {

FTPClient ftpClient = null;

try {

ftpClient = new FTPClient();

ftpClient.connect(ftpHost, ftpPort);// 连接FTP服务器

ftpClient.login(ftpUserName, ftpPassword);// 登陆FTP服务器

if (!FTPReply.isPositiveCompletion(ftpClient.getReplyCode())) {

logger.info("未连接到FTP,用户名或密码错误。");

ftpClient.disconnect();

} else {

logger.info("FTP连接成功。");

}

} catch (SocketException e) {

e.printStackTrace();

logger.info("FTP的IP地址可能错误,请正确配置。");

} catch (IOException e) {

e.printStackTrace();

logger.info("FTP的端口错误,请正确配置。");

}

return ftpClient;

}

}

3.编写一个读取FTP上文件的类ReadFTPFile.java

package com.metarnet.ftp.read; 

import java.io.BufferedReader;

import java.io.FileInputStream;

import java.io.FileNotFoundException;

import java.io.IOException;

import java.io.InputStream;

import java.io.InputStreamReader;

import java.net.SocketException;

import org.apache.commons.net.ftp.FTPClient;

import org.apache.log4j.Logger;

import com.metarnet.ftp.util.FTPUtil;

public class ReadFTPFile {

private Logger logger = Logger.getLogger(ReadFTPFile.class);

/**

* 去 服务器的FTP路径下上读取文件

*

* @param ftpUserName

* @param ftpPassword

* @param ftpPath

* @param FTPServer

* @return

*/

public String readConfigFileForFTP(String ftpUserName, String ftpPassword,

String ftpPath, String ftpHost, int ftpPort, String fileName) {

StringBuffer resultBuffer = new StringBuffer();

FileInputStream inFile = null;

InputStream in = null;

FTPClient ftpClient = null;

logger.info("开始读取绝对路径" + ftpPath + "文件!");

try {

ftpClient = FTPUtil.getFTPClient(ftpHost, ftpPassword, ftpUserName,

ftpPort);

ftpClient.setControlEncoding("UTF-8"); // 中文支持

ftpClient.setFileType(FTPClient.BINARY_FILE_TYPE);

ftpClient.enterLocalPassiveMode();

ftpClient.changeWorkingDirectory(ftpPath);

in = ftpClient.retrieveFileStream(fileName);

} catch (FileNotFoundException e) {

logger.error("没有找到" + ftpPath + "文件");

e.printStackTrace();

return "下载配置文件失败,请联系管理员.";

} catch (SocketException e) {

logger.error("连接FTP失败.");

e.printStackTrace();

} catch (IOException e) {

e.printStackTrace();

logger.error("文件读取错误。");

e.printStackTrace();

return "配置文件读取失败,请联系管理员.";

}

if (in != null) {

BufferedReader br = new BufferedReader(new InputStreamReader(in));

String data = null;

try {

while ((data = br.readLine()) != null) {

resultBuffer.append(data + "\n");

}

} catch (IOException e) {

logger.error("文件读取错误。");

e.printStackTrace();

return "配置文件读取失败,请联系管理员.";

}finally{

try {

ftpClient.disconnect();

} catch (IOException e) {

e.printStackTrace();

}

}

}else{

logger.error("in为空,不能读取。");

return "配置文件读取失败,请联系管理员.";

}

return resultBuffer.toString();

}

}

4.创建一个往FTP上写入文件的类WriteFTPFile.java

package com.metarnet.ftp.write; 

import java.io.BufferedWriter;

import java.io.File;

import java.io.FileInputStream;

import java.io.FileWriter;

import java.io.IOException;

import java.io.InputStream;

import org.apache.commons.net.ftp.FTPClient;

import org.apache.commons.net.ftp.FTPFile;

import org.apache.log4j.Logger;

import com.metarnet.ftp.util.FTPUtil;

public class WriteFTPFile {

private Logger logger = Logger.getLogger(WriteFTPFile.class);

/**

* 本地上传文件到FTP服务器

*

* @param ftpPath

* 远程文件路径FTP

* @throws IOException

*/

public void upload(String ftpPath, String ftpUserName, String ftpPassword,

String ftpHost, int ftpPort, String fileContent,

String writeTempFielPath) {

FTPClient ftpClient = null;

logger.info("开始上传文件到FTP.");

try {

ftpClient = FTPUtil.getFTPClient(ftpHost, ftpPassword,

ftpUserName, ftpPort);

// 设置PassiveMode传输

ftpClient.enterLocalPassiveMode();

// 设置以二进制流的方式传输

ftpClient.setFileType(FTPClient.BINARY_FILE_TYPE);

// 对远程目录的处理

String remoteFileName = ftpPath;

if (ftpPath.contains("/")) {

remoteFileName = ftpPath

.substring(ftpPath.lastIndexOf("/") + 1);

}

// FTPFile[] files = ftpClient.listFiles(new

// String(remoteFileName));

// 先把文件写在本地。在上传到FTP上最后在删除

boolean writeResult = write(remoteFileName, fileContent,

writeTempFielPath);

if (writeResult) {

File f = new File(writeTempFielPath + "/" + remoteFileName);

InputStream in = new FileInputStream(f);

ftpClient.storeFile(remoteFileName, in);

in.close();

logger.info("上传文件" + remoteFileName + "到FTP成功!");

f.delete();

} else {

logger.info("写文件失败!");

}

} catch (Exception e) {

e.printStackTrace();

}finally{

try {

ftpClient.disconnect();

} catch (IOException e) {

e.printStackTrace();

}

}

}

/**

* 把配置文件先写到本地的一个文件中取

*

* @param ftpPath

* @param str

* @return

*/

public boolean write(String fileName, String fileContext,

String writeTempFielPath) {

try {

logger.info("开始写配置文件");

File f = new File(writeTempFielPath + "/" + fileName);

if(!f.exists()){

if(!f.createNewFile()){

logger.info("文件不存在,创建失败!");

}

}

BufferedWriter bw = new BufferedWriter(new FileWriter(f, true));

bw.write(fileContext.replaceAll("\n", "\r\n"));

bw.flush();

bw.close();

return true;

} catch (Exception e) {

logger.error("写文件没有成功");

e.printStackTrace();

return false;

}

}

}

5.建立一个测试类FTPMain.java

package com.metarnet.ftp.main; 

import java.io.InputStream;

import java.util.Properties;

import org.apache.log4j.Logger;

import com.metarnet.ftp.read.ReadFTPFile;

import com.metarnet.ftp.util.FTPUtil;

import com.metarnet.ftp.write.WriteFTPFile;

public class FTPMain {

private static Logger logger = Logger.getLogger(FTPMain.class);

public static void main(String[] args) {

int ftpPort = 0;

String ftpUserName = "";

String ftpPassword = "";

String ftpHost = "";

String ftpPath = "";

String writeTempFielPath = "";

try {

InputStream in = FTPUtil.class.getClassLoader()

.getResourceAsStream("env.properties");

if (in == null) {

logger.info("配置文件env.properties读取失败");

} else {

Properties properties = new Properties();

properties.load(in);

ftpUserName = properties.getProperty("ftpUserName");

ftpPassword = properties.getProperty("ftpPassword");

ftpHost = properties.getProperty("ftpHost");

ftpPort = Integer.valueOf(properties.getProperty("ftpPort"))

.intValue();

ftpPath = properties.getProperty("ftpPath");

writeTempFielPath = properties.getProperty("writeTempFielPath");

ReadFTPFile read = new ReadFTPFile();

String result = read.readConfigFileForFTP(ftpUserName, ftpPassword, ftpPath, ftpHost, ftpPort, "huawei_220.248.192.200.cfg");

System.out.println("读取配置文件结果为:" + result);

WriteFTPFile write = new WriteFTPFile();

ftpPath = ftpPath + "/" + "huawei_220.248.192.200_new1.cfg";

write.upload(ftpPath, ftpUserName, ftpPassword, ftpHost, ftpPort, result, writeTempFielPath);

}

} catch (Exception e) {

e.printStackTrace();

}

}

}
